Empire is based on the holy roman empire and uses many German names.
Most vampires lvie in Sylvania, a former province of the Empire.
Therefore they have German names similar to the Empire.

Idk about the vampire pirates

At least Count Noctilus is a von Carstein, his old name is Nyklaus von Carstein of Sylvania. He decided that he likes the sea better than the murky East and so he changed his name and went pirate. His fellow Vampirates have different origins though...
